[QUOTE="Just Carl, post: 673706, member: 4552"]I'm not a dealer but going to 2 to 4 coin shows a month I've gotten to know many dealers well. A few give me a large amount of Albums and folders free. Some time ago I wondered the same thing about dealers hoarding certain coins. So I started asking about the 31D Mercury Dime as an example since it is the 4th lowest minted coin in the series. Every single dealer said no way. I also asked about the new Lincoln Cents and was basically told the same. Every dealer I discussed this with said basically the same thing, that they are in the buisness to make money now, not tomorrow. A few of the dealers that also had stores did mention some hoarding of what may in the future be of some value and that is because they have the room in the store for such hoarding. But the largest amount of dealers do not have that luxury of large storage rooms so they sell as much as they can when they have them.[/QUOTE]
